- Highlights: Zein and poly(lactic acid) (PLA) were blended to make biodegradable packaging. Polyethylene glycol and eugenol were used as plasticizer and antimicrobial agent. Mechanical, water and gas barrier properties of zein films were largely improved. Eugenol added films showed similar antimicrobial effects as pure eugenol. Abstract: Biodegradable packaging is more eco-friendly compared with the synthetic plastics. To improve the physical properties of the zein films, poly(lactic acid) (PLA) was mixed with zein to make a biodegradable blend film. The composition of the film with the best properties was the one with zein and PLA in the mass ratio of 1:1 with the addition of 20% poly(ethylene glycol) as the plasticizer. The incorporation of PLA significantly increased the elongation, reduced the tensile strength, and decreased the water vapor and gas permeabilities of zein films. The antimicrobial agent eugenol added in the film significantly inhibited the growth of both S. aureus and E. coli . The migration tests were conducted to confirm the safety of the blend films. This is the first-time report of zein-PLA blend film. The antimicrobial zein-PLA-eugenol film with enhanced mechanical and barrier properties has a high potential as active biodegradable food packaging.
